Each year in Finland, some 20,000 or so men are subject to conscription, while another 1,000 or so women volunteer. They are the core of the country’s military strategy and all the more central since Russia’s invasion of Ukraine.

United Nations investigators have verified six additional Russian executions of Ukrainian prisoners of war in the year after Moscow’s full-scale invasion, according to a report released on Wednesday by the UN human rights office.

Russian movie theaters are employing a workaround to give audiences access to the Western films they want to watch, including Greta Gerwig’s blockbuster film “Barbie.” The screenings are just one example of how Russians have been forced to improvise after Moscow’s full-scale invasion of Ukraine.
